Output e59ac0dfff1d8eb354378c24036ae1b974652b1ec278d102a45c3d056651d9f6:0

value
610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 149563834f6d5fe27d99132aeaa4265ce6eafd9f OP_EQUAL
address
33ZrQ6DaS3HehuEq4DNHNwPGwmWLUz5oFq
transaction
e59ac0dfff1d8eb354378c24036ae1b974652b1ec278d102a45c3d056651d9f6
spent
true